Even the best gas turbine seals can face problems. One common issue is wear and tear. Over time, seals can get damaged due to heat, pressure, and movement. If the seal wears out, it can allow air and gas to leak. This can make the machine less efficient. Just like how old tires on a car can make it harder to drive, worn seals can cause machines to work harder and use more fuel. Another problem is contamination. Sometimes dirt or other particles can get into the seals. This can cause them to break down faster. Imagine trying to ride a bike with a flat tire; it’s harder to go fast. Contaminated seals can slow down machines and lead to more frequent repairs. Also, if the seals are not installed correctly, they can fail. It’s important for workers to follow the right steps when putting in seals. A small mistake can lead to big problems later. Temperature changes can also affect seal performance. If it gets too hot or too cold, seals might not work as well. They can become hard or soft, which stops them from sealing tightly. Another issue is vibration. Gas turbines move a lot and create vibrations. If the seals can’t handle these vibrations, they may break down.
